Spotting the Real Differences: Day vs. Night Variants

At a glance, day and night sanitary pads might seem similar, but their designs serve completely different purposes. Confusing the two is a common mistake that often leads to frustrating overnight leaks and extra laundry. The key differences lie in their length, core placement, and how they are engineered to handle fluid.

Day pads are built for an upright, active body. They are typically shorter, with an absorbent core concentrated in the center and front. This design works well when you are standing or sitting, as gravity directs flow downward into the core. However, when you lie down to sleep, this design becomes a liability. Fluid is no longer directed by gravity in the same way and can easily run past the shorter front or back edges, especially if you sleep on your stomach or back.

Night pads, on the other hand, are specifically engineered for a horizontal body. They are noticeably longer, with extended rear coverage to prevent back leaks—the most common type of overnight stain. The absorbent core is also wider and more evenly distributed, designed to capture and lock away fluid that spreads sideways. This construction anticipates the way flow behaves when you are lying down for many hours. Choosing a night variant for sleep isn’t about preference; it is a practical decision that directly impacts your ability to get an uninterrupted, worry-free rest.

How Winged Design and Core Placement Secure Heavy Flow

The secret to a leak-proof night often comes down to two critical features: secure wings and a strategically placed core. While absorbency is important, it means nothing if the pad shifts out of place. This is why understanding how to use these features correctly is essential for preventing stains and ensuring you feel secure all night long.

The wings on a night pad are your first line of defense against side leaks. They are not just for show; they create a physical barrier and anchor the pad firmly to your underwear. To get a truly secure fit, follow these simple steps:

  1. Position the Pad: First, place the main body of the pad onto the crotch of your underwear, making sure the wider, longer end is at the back.
  2. Fold the Wings: Peel the paper off the wings and fold them firmly around the outside of your underwear's seams.
  3. Press and Seal: Press down on the wings to ensure the adhesive grips the fabric tightly. This creates a "seal" that prevents the pad from twisting or sliding, even if you are a restless sleeper.

Once secured, the absorbent core can do its job effectively. The core in a heavy-flow night pad is not just a uniform sponge. It features a longer, wider design that extends much farther toward the back. This is a direct response to how fluid moves when you are lying on your back or side. As you sleep, any sudden surges are channeled toward this extended rear section, where the pad has the most capacity. This targeted design means that even if you shift from your side to your back, the protection moves with you, capturing fluid before it has a chance to reach your sheets. By mastering the placement of a winged night pad, you effectively eliminate the “shifting” problem that causes most overnight accidents.

Staying Comfortable Without Bulk in Tropical Climates

One of the biggest concerns with heavy-flow protection is the fear of feeling like you are wearing a diaper. The idea of thick, bulky padding can be especially unappealing in warm, humid environments where comfort is paramount. The good news is that modern night pads are designed to provide maximum security without the uncomfortable bulk of older products.

The key to this improved comfort lies in advanced materials and a streamlined design. Instead of just adding more padding, today’s heavy-flow night pads use a layered approach:

  • Moisture-Wicking Top Layer: The surface that touches your skin is made from a soft, perforated material that pulls moisture away instantly. This keeps you feeling dry and reduces the risk of skin irritation.
  • Breathable Side Panels: While the core is designed for maximum absorption, the sides and wings are often made from a more breathable, cloth-like material. This allows air to circulate, reducing heat and moisture buildup that can feel stuffy on a warm night.
  • Compressed Core Technology: The absorbent core itself is made of super-absorbent polymers that can lock away a large amount of fluid in a surprisingly thin layer. This provides heavy-flow capacity without the excessive thickness.

To further enhance your comfort, you can pair your pad with smart sleep habits. Opt for sleepwear made from natural, breathable fabrics like cotton or bamboo. Avoid tight-fitting synthetic materials that trap heat. Keeping your bedroom cool with a fan or air conditioning can also make a significant difference, allowing you to enjoy the full security of your night pad without feeling overheated.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

  1. Q: How many hours can a heavy-flow night pad safely handle before needing a change?
    A: You can typically wear one for 8 to 10 hours during sleep. If you experience peak flow on your first two nights, consider changing right before bed and immediately upon waking to maintain dryness and skin comfort in warm climates.
  2. Q: Do wings actually prevent side leaks during restless sleep?
    A: Yes, when folded correctly around your underwear's leg openings. The wings create a physical barrier that stops flow from escaping sideways, even when you shift positions. Ensure the adhesive strips are fully pressed down for a secure seal.
  3. Q: Can I use a day pad overnight if I only have light bleeding?
    A: It is not recommended. Day pads lack the extended rear coverage and wider core needed for horizontal flow while lying down. Even with light bleeding, overnight movement can push fluid past the shorter edges, increasing the chance of sheet stains.
  4. Q: How do I know if the pad’s absorbency matches my heavy flow needs?
    A: Check for labels indicating "night," "heavy flow," or "extended coverage." These variants feature deeper core layers and reinforced channels that distribute sudden surges. Pairing the right variant with high-waisted, snug underwear maximizes leak protection.
